Output 93c40b4b68eab11aebf8411df9739f0a7435ec50c2f145a85b3373ffdd36ccc2:4

value
26000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f352b6302a3c3ad097a8f385d43753bb592290 OP_EQUAL
address
3D5hCiTToxpAi7nQuZifrS6EMnkq2i7ydJ
transaction
93c40b4b68eab11aebf8411df9739f0a7435ec50c2f145a85b3373ffdd36ccc2
spent
true